CA – Accounts & Finance Job Description Template
As a Chartered Accountant in Accounts & Finance, you will play a critical role in overseeing financial operations, ensuring regulatory compliance, and advising on financial strategy. Your expertise will help drive financial efficiency and business growth.
Responsibilities
- Manage and oversee the daily operations of the accounting department.
- Monitor and analyze accounting data and produce financial reports or statements.
- Establish and enforce proper accounting methods, policies, and principles.
- Coordinate and complete annual audits.
- Ensure compliance with all financial regulations and standards.
- Prepare budget forecasts and conduct financial analysis to assist in decision-making.
- Review and recommend updates to accounting systems and practices.
- Provide strategic financial guidance and recommendations to management.
Qualifications
- Chartered Accountant (CA) certification.
- Bachelor's degree in Finance, Accounting, or a related field.
- Minimum of 5 years of experience in accounting or finance.
- Proven experience in financial management and reporting.
- In-depth knowledge of accounting principles, laws, and standards.
- Strong analytical and problem-solving skills.
- Excellent communication and leadership abilities.
- High level of attention to detail and accuracy.

A CA in Accounts & Finance is responsible for managing financial records, analyzing financial data, ensuring compliance with accounting standards, and offering strategic financial advice. They handle budgets, forecasts, audits, and manage taxation matters, playing a critical role in financial planning and decision-making.
To become a CA in Accounts & Finance, one must complete a recognized Chartered Accountancy program, which involves passing a series of exams and gaining practical work experience. This typically requires strong analytical skills, proficiency in accounting software, and a deep understanding of finance regulations and standards.
